Image: Cavan Images/ Cavan/ Getty ImagesWood is just one of the most typical sorts of fences for lawns due to the fact that it can offer multiple functions while appealing to lots of preferences.





You can choose from various wood fence designs, like lattice patterns, straight slat secure fencing, picket styles, or upright canine ear fencing panels (when makers cut the ideas of the boards at an inclined angle), to match your home's visual. Make a design statement with color, such as dark wood for a much more modern-day design or all-natural timber for a rustic feeling.


River Valley Fencing Fundamentals Explained


Compared to other materials, wood is among the extra budget-friendly alternatives. Keep in mind, nonetheless, that wood is sensitive to the aspects and weather condition changes. It's susceptible to fading and needs normal maintenance every few years, so make up the expense of staining the fencing and maintenance when budgeting.

Photo:/ Adobe StockA corrugated metal fencing marries form and function. The solid metal panels develop an outstanding personal privacy obstacle, keeping passersby from seeing what's taking place in your yard.


Usually, corrugated metal fencings are bordered by wooden frames, providing an industrial-chic look. The fencings are incredibly long lasting and cost effective when compared to other metal fencing choices.
